What is an apostrophe?An apostrophe used as a contraction replaces a letter such as 'can't' the apostrophe replaces the 'o' in 'not' another common example would be 'it's' as in 'it is'. The apostrophe replaces the 'i' in 'is'.
To show possession take the noun and add an apostrophe and an 's' such as 'Mrs. Noble's friend' The apostrophe and the 's' show possession. If the noun is plural or already ends in an 's' do not put an 's' again
For example 'the birds' tree is lovely' Birds as in many birds if it was one bird it would be 'the bird's tree is lovely'.

The narrator determines the story's point of view in a work of fiction. The narrative is said to be in the first person if the narrator is a complete participant in the story's action. A 3rd person narrative is a story given by a narrator who is not a character in the story, so when you read a story, the narrator is always the one person who is talking about everyone else.
